Lamborghini Driving Event
Lamborghini chose Millbrook for a performance-focused driving event that included the new Lamborghini Aventador S Coupe and Roadster models.
The event was hosted over four days and attended by more than 100 potential customers. This dealer event was organised on behalf of the Italian brand’s UK dealers.
Attendees experienced the Lamborghini super sports cars on Millbrook’s varied selection of test tracks.
Millbrook’s Mile Straight allowed Lamborghini to show prospective customers the performance potential from its uprated, naturally-aspirated V12 engine in the Aventador S models. The Hill Route, set up to simulate challenging European roads, enabled drivers to explore Lamborghini’s new four-wheel steering system. The High Speed Circuit, featuring two miles of banked track, demonstrated the Aventador’s four-wheel drive stability and grip. Drivers also had use of the 15,000-square meter steering pad in front of Millbrook’s Concept 1 conference venue for handling activities.
MAN Truck & Bus UK Driving Event
Around 120 delegates were present on each day.
Millbrook’s Hill Route – with gradients up to 26% – allowed MAN to demonstrate their products’ braking and stability control systems. The City Circuit emulated city driving, as the delegates tackled road humps and tested parking assist systems. The High Speed Circuit simulated motorway conditions.

Hyundai came to Millbrook for its exhilarating test driving event for prospective customers of the new i30 N performance hatchback.
Millbrook’s Mile Straight allowed Hyundai to show prospective customers the performance potential of its vehicles, while the Hill Route, set up to simulate challenging European roads, enabled drivers to replicate tight and twisty corners in the i30 N. The High Speed Circuit, featuring two miles of banked track, demonstrated the Hyundai’s stability and grip.

Mercedes-Benz Trucks UK RoadEfficiency LIVE Driving Event
The dealer event included a test of the range capability of the vehicles, giving customers the opportunity to drive the vehicles around a set course starting from outside Concept 1, Millbrook’s largest venue. The event saw a demonstration of the new electric truck – the FUSO eCanter.
The team brought FuelChallenger vehicles to the event. These Actros 2545s went out on a 5.5mile / 15 minute route from Concept 1, including Loops 1 and 2 of the Hill Route and one lap of the High Speed Circuit.
Attendees were challenged to maximise their fuel consumption, with a prize for the highest mpg of each day.
Delegates were walked through the company’s CASE strategy and insights into the future, using the venue space to comfortably seat delegates for the presentation.
